Identifying negative thoughts influenced by the Food Police primarily serves to challenge cognitive distortions. The Food Police represents the internalized messages or beliefs that create guilt and shame surrounding eating behaviors. These thoughts can distort one’s perception of food, leading to harmful attitudes such as labeling foods as "good" or "bad" and fostering an unhealthy relationship with eating.

By recognizing and challenging these cognitive distortions, individuals can reframe their thinking, which is essential for developing a healthier mindset toward food. This process encourages self-compassion and acceptance, which are core tenets of Intuitive Eating. It allows individuals to move away from a punitive mindset towards a more balanced and understanding approach to their dietary choices.

The other options, like promoting moralistic eating habits or encouraging strict dieting, oppose the fundamental principles of Intuitive Eating, which aims for a flexible, attuned approach to one's body's needs. Recognizing and addressing the Food Police’s negative influence helps to create a supportive environment for fostering more intuitive and mindful eating practices.
